Study of PDR001 and/or MBG453 in Combination With Decitabine in Patients With AML or High Risk MDS

Completed · Phase 1

Conditions studied: Leukemia, Leukemia, Myeloid, Leukemia, Myeloid, Acute, Myelodysplastic Syndromes, Preleukemia, Bone Marrow Diseases, Hematologic Diseases, Chronic Myelomonocytic Leukemia

In brief

To characterize the safety and tolerability of 1) MBG453 as a single agent or in combination with PDR001 or 2) PDR001 and/or MBG453 in combination with decitabine or azacitidine in AML and intermediate or high- risk MDS patients, and to identify recommended doses for future studies.
